Transaction 681d9dac83a4f1def82e23cc4979b7bc7b042e80b31245de95ec777f55392ada
2 Input
2 Outputs
- 681d9dac83a4f1def82e23cc4979b7bc7b042e80b31245de95ec777f55392ada:0
- 681d9dac83a4f1def82e23cc4979b7bc7b042e80b31245de95ec777f55392ada:1
value 50000000
address 38aZmrThKwYc69rvaARCHjzH3M6hkbqA8p
value 96328490095
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g